The Bosphorus Bridge and the Transition

The city straddles the Bosphorus Strait, dividing Europe from Asia. This maritime gateway creates a transitional climate, with mild winters and warm summers influenced by the Black Sea to the north and the Aegean Sea to the south. It s like a living illustration of the Köppen climate classification, oscillating between temperate and subtropical.

Climate and Culture

The changing seasons have long influenced Istanbul s lifestyle and traditions. Spring festivals, like Tulip Festival, celebrate the city s rebirth after the chilly winter. And the warmth of summer invites locals to enjoy rooftop cafes and outdoor markets. It s a climate that mirrors the city s vibrant, ever-evolving spirit.
